Hi, Does anyone know the Best Fit or other replacement part system numbers for balance staffs on the WWII Seth Thomas Navy Clocks. There are three platfrom escapements, R-18565 (Old Platform), R-20666 (New Platform) and R-20695 (Elgin)? The ROUND platforms are made by Elgin, and I believe that a 16s Elgin staff fits. The older, rectangular platforms used staffs and other parts that were not exactly mass produced, but were custom fitted together during final assembly and testing. I believe that Ron Bechler in San Jose told me about the Elgin part, so he may have the actual staff number.
